How It Works
At its core, Claude Code employs advanced algorithms to analyze code patterns and predict the next lines of code needed. This predictive capability is achieved through machine learning models trained on vast datasets of existing code. The system learns from user inputs and feedback, continually refining its suggestions to align more closely with developer preferences.
Technical Mechanisms
- Machine Learning Models: Trained on diverse codebases, these models can understand context and syntax.
- Feedback Loops: Users can correct or modify suggestions, helping improve future outputs.
- Integration APIs: Seamlessly integrates with existing IDEs to enhance the development workflow.

Potential Challenges and Considerations
While the benefits of Claude Code's auto mode are evident, organizations must also consider potential challenges:
Key Challenges
- Overreliance on Automation: Teams may become too dependent on automated suggestions, potentially stunting their coding skills.
- Integration Issues: Existing workflows may require adjustments to fully leverage auto mode's capabilities.
- Quality Control: Organizations must implement measures to ensure automated outputs meet quality standards.
Strategies to Mitigate Risks
- Regular training sessions to keep developers updated on best practices.
- Establishing review processes for automated code outputs.
